Jenesse Welcomes the Iconic Mary J. Blige to Perform at the Silver Rose Gala & Auction, Saturday, April 14th at Beverly Hills Hotel


LOS ANGELES, CA, Apr 12, 2012 (MARKETWIRE via COMTEX) -- Jenesse Center is proud to welcome the incomparable nine-time Grammy Award winning recording artist Mary J. Blige to perform at the 2012 Silver Rose Gala and Auction on Saturday, April 14, 2012 at the Beverly Hills Hotel and Bungalows at 6:00pm.
An iconic American artist who has defined many key moments in the musical landscape of our time, Blige is ranked by Billboard Magazine as the "Most successful female R&B artist of the past 25 years." She is also ranked by VH1as one of the "100 Greatest Women in Music" and by Rolling Stone Magazine as one of the "100 Greatest Singers of All Time."
Avis Frazier-Thomas, Jenesse Board President, said, "We are honored and overjoyed to welcome one of the greatest artists of our time, Mary J. Blige. She exemplifies the heart of many women here in America and around the globe. Her music is a message of hope and joy, which is why it is such a privilege to have her join us to spread Jenesse's message of hope to women and families everywhere."
The event will raise funds and salute important community figures who advance Jenesse Center's mission to protect families from the ravages of domestic violence. Jenesse Center is a national non-profit domestic violence intervention and prevention organization that provides a holistic, comprehensive program to nurture victimized families back to a place of mental, financial, physical and emotional well-being.
The theme for the 2012 Silver Rose is "Welcome." Frazier-Thomas said, "We chose the theme 'Welcome' because it's a simple word that embodies the hopes and dreams of families looking for a fresh start. It's the affirmation that lets people know they are home."
This year's distinguished 2012 Silver Rose Honorees include Ingrid Roberts, Managing Director for First Picks Management and Xerox Corporation, who will be recognized at the Silver Rose Gala and Auction, and Paula Williams Madison, who will be recognized at the 4th Annual Halle Berry Celebrity Golf Classic on Monday, April 16, 2012 at Wilshire Country Club. These individuals and corporations are representative of Jenesse's strategic vision to change the world by welcoming the very best ideas and opportunities for families.
Jenesse is proud to present the first ever Fannie Lou Hamer Award to Schinal Walker, a former Jenesse client who is now an active spokesperson and advocate for women and girls overcoming domestic violence. Walker said, "No matter what we are feeling, it makes it worse when we feel it alone. We must use our voice to educate these women and girls who are battered and abused or in danger of that, and I will not stop using mine. Never again will I silence my voice! I will continue to raise awareness and take a stance. This is just the beginning!"
Women from the Jenesse shelter will design the floral arrangements for this year's event, which will be available for auction at the end of the gala. The event planners joined with Jenesse this year to teach the skill set of masterful floral design to the women, so they would learn a new skill set and enjoy an opportunity to contribute to success of the gala event. Guests who bid on the floral arrangements will take home a treasure that was literally touched by one of the women who Jenesse helps and who represents the reason the event is produced. Silver Rose Gala Chair Pat Greene said, "We are proud of the women from our shelter who were hands on in designing our floral arrangements this year. I have seen the arrangements and they are stunning. What is more spectacular is the joy the women had in producing them and the pride they feel in not just designing the flowers but designing their own destiny to move towards hope and a fresh start in life."
The official sponsors of the 2012 Silver Rose Weekend include Xerox, Verizon, BET Networks, Ciroc, Nestle USA, NBC Universal, SEIU ULTCW, Southwest Airlines, Good Works Makes A Difference and The Tyler Foundation For Disabilities. Karen Earl, Executive Director of the Jenesse Center, said, "Jenesse Center has been fortunate to draw sponsors who make our mission their own and we are grateful for their contribution to help give women and families peace and a chance at a new beginning."
Halle Berry, Silver Rose Chairperson, said, "The Silver Rose Weekend will raise much needed funds and awareness to help families victimized by domestic violence. Over the past 14 years, I've watched the lives of countless families transformed and I am excited about the future for these families as we work to build on our success and bring an end to their suffering one family at a time."

There's been a lot of talk lately about a potential spin-off to NBC's The Office tentatively titled The Farm, following the one and only Dwight Schrute. And while that sounds appealing, more often than not the spin-off doesn't live up or even come close to the original. Joey. However, one of the really great spin-offs of recent memory was Frasier, which managed to put out eleven seasons of a distinct and equally funny series.

After Cheers closed its doors, Dr. Frasier Crane moved to Seattle and started a radio show where he provided free psychiatric advice to just about anyone who felt like calling in. And, what many people don't know is, many of those callers were celebrity cameos and now you can see just who was ringing in with what problem thanks to this collection. It's actually a little surprising and pretty impressive wide variety of stars that NBC managed to get over the years. Take a look.


Video via Pajiba.

The six minute video contains countless callers and a lot of them are quite funny. Some of my favorites include a young Macaulay Culkin pulling a Home Alone like routine (oddly enough, a young Elijah Wood also calls, which makes a Good Son six degrees of Kevin Bacon kind of connection, even stranger because Bacon himself calls), Gary Sinese and his fear of talking on the phone, Jon Lithgow hawking his used cars and, of course, Carrie Fisher telling him, "help me Dr. Crane, you're my only hope." Actually almost every cameo in the six minute video offers a least a chuckle and it's definitely worth the watch. I miss this show, Grammer's a little more serious on Boss.
